Building Resilience in the Digital Age: Mastering Fault Tolerant System Design and Development with an Advanced Certificate

August 05, 2025 4 min read Hannah Young

Master fault-tolerant system design and development with an advanced certificate and build resilient systems that withstand failures.

In today's fast-paced, technology-driven world, system failures can have catastrophic consequences, from financial losses to reputational damage. As a result, organizations are increasingly seeking professionals with expertise in designing and developing fault-tolerant systems that can withstand failures and maintain uninterrupted service. An Advanced Certificate in Fault Tolerant System Design and Development is a highly specialized program that equips individuals with the essential skills, knowledge, and best practices to create resilient systems. In this blog post, we'll delve into the key aspects of this advanced certificate, exploring the essential skills, best practices, and career opportunities that come with it.

Essential Skills for Fault Tolerant System Design and Development

To excel in fault-tolerant system design and development, professionals need to possess a unique combination of technical, analytical, and problem-solving skills. Some of the essential skills include proficiency in programming languages such as Java, C++, and Python, as well as experience with cloud computing platforms like Amazon Web Services (AWS) or Microsoft Azure. Additionally, knowledge of distributed systems, microservices architecture, and containerization using Docker is crucial. Furthermore, professionals should be well-versed in testing and validation techniques, including fault injection and chaos engineering, to ensure that systems can withstand various types of failures. By acquiring these skills, individuals can develop a strong foundation in fault-tolerant system design and development, enabling them to create robust and reliable systems.

Best Practices for Fault Tolerant System Design and Development

When it comes to designing and developing fault-tolerant systems, there are several best practices that professionals should follow. One of the most critical best practices is to adopt a proactive approach to failure, anticipating and planning for potential failures rather than reacting to them after they occur. This involves conducting thorough risk assessments, identifying single points of failure, and implementing redundancy and failover mechanisms. Another best practice is to use agile development methodologies, such as DevOps and Continuous Integration/Continuous Deployment (CI/CD), to ensure that systems are designed and developed with fault tolerance in mind from the outset. Moreover, professionals should prioritize continuous monitoring and testing, using tools like Prometheus and Grafana to detect potential issues before they become incidents. By following these best practices, professionals can ensure that their systems are designed and developed with resilience and reliability in mind.

Career Opportunities in Fault Tolerant System Design and Development

The demand for professionals with expertise in fault-tolerant system design and development is on the rise, driven by the increasing need for organizations to ensure high levels of system availability and reliability. With an Advanced Certificate in Fault Tolerant System Design and Development, individuals can pursue a range of career opportunities, from system architect and software engineer to DevOps engineer and cloud computing specialist. These professionals can work in various industries, including finance, healthcare, and e-commerce, where system failures can have significant consequences. According to industry reports, the job market for fault-tolerant system design and development professionals is expected to grow significantly in the coming years, with salaries ranging from $100,000 to over $200,000 depending on experience and location. By acquiring this advanced certificate, individuals can position themselves for success in this exciting and rapidly evolving field.

Staying Ahead of the Curve: Emerging Trends and Technologies

The field of fault-tolerant system design and development is constantly evolving, with new trends and technologies emerging all the time. One of the most significant trends is the increasing use of artificial intelligence (AI) and machine learning (ML) to enhance system resilience and reliability. Professionals should also be aware of the growing importance of edge computing, which involves processing data at the edge of the network, closer to the source of the data. Additionally, the use of serverless computing and function-as-a-service (FaaS) is becoming more prevalent, offering new opportunities for building fault-tolerant systems.

Ready to Transform Your Career?

Take the next step in your professional journey with our comprehensive course designed for business leaders

Disclaimer

The views and opinions expressed in this blog are those of the individual authors and do not necessarily reflect the official policy or position of LSBR UK - Executive Education. The content is created for educational purposes by professionals and students as part of their continuous learning journey. LSBR UK - Executive Education does not guarantee the accuracy, completeness, or reliability of the information presented. Any action you take based on the information in this blog is strictly at your own risk. LSBR UK - Executive Education and its affiliates will not be liable for any losses or damages in connection with the use of this blog content.

6,191 views
Back to Blog

This course help you to:

  • Boost your Salary
  • Increase your Professional Reputation, and
  • Expand your Networking Opportunities

Ready to take the next step?

Enrol now in the

Advanced Certificate in Fault Tolerant System Design and Development

Enrol Now